"Rustic, Charming, Authentic, Spiritual"...these are the words we hear
over and over from our guests. We boast thousands of trees on the 14
acres of unspoiled land adjacent to the Rocky Mountain National Park.
Over 600 feet of the Fall River is on our retreat. Up the mountain from
Pine Haven is Old Man Mountain, a beautiful sight indeed. It is also
known as "Sitting Man" by the Indians. Old Man Mountain is recognized
as one of the top 38 Sacred Sites in the United States. |
